They introduced a rule for the rear fogs where they could only come on when headlights were on dip. They then had to cancel when switched off and the pcb would also cancel them so going back onto dip did not automatically put them back on. The rear fog switch was also of the type that was for activating the logic pcb, a “momentary on “ type.. AIM was to prevent the forgetful from driving with them on...not good for followers in the rain.
